Power Dynamos start league title defense with a tie against Prison

Prison Leopards have recorded their second draw in two consecutive matches, their first against Zesco United.

Power Dynamos, Zambia’s defending Super League Champions, were held to a goalless draw by Prison Leopards in their opening League match of the season.

After defeating African Stars of Namibia 1 to nil over the weekend to advance to the next round of the CAF Champions League, Power Dynamos sought to get off to a great start in this match.

However, it was the home team that had the better of the opening exchanges, as Junior Zulu and Landu Meite both missed clear-cut opportunities.

Power Dynamos had a chance of their own five minutes before half-time, but Joshua Mutale saw his effort saved by Jeff Lungu.

Head Coach Mwenya Chipepo made alterations as a result of Power Dynamos’ poor start to the game, replacing Kalenji Mwepu and Brian Mulanbia with Salulani Phiri and Jacob Kunda.

Salulani came near to score, but Leopard’s goalie handled his lightning-fast strike expertly to the disappointment of Aba yellow fans.

The two goalkeepers played their best to keep the scores low despite both teams having opportunities to take the lead.

After 90 minutes, there was no way to distinguish the two teams, and the home squad recorded their second tie in two consecutive matches.

The focus will now shift to this Saturday’s match between Power Dynamos and Konkola Blades, while Prison Leopards will take on Green Buffaloes.
